KRISTOFFER KJOS AS is registered as a limited company in Hole, Buskerud with organisation number 979979576. The business is classified under freight transport by road (NACE 49.410). The company was incorporated in 1998 and has 12 registered employees. Registered share capital is NOK 100,000, divided into 100 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Lastebiltransport samt deltagelse i selskaper med beslektet virksomhet.”.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2025 financial year, show NOK 34.4m in revenue and NOK 4.6m in operating profit.
